thats about how much old shifter carts go for. I know a guy who races them who just about gives his frames away after a season. I guess the carts soften up and you need to keep buying fresh chassis to stay competitive.

I raced a 100cc kart for years. It's a blast. On those brake lines. Measure them and talk to Earl's in Indy to order AN -3 brake lines. Don't go cheap on that plus tech may not like it. You got a great deal on a old cart, spend some money and make it fast!!!
60mph is nothing after you drive a shifter kart. I was shaking 1 hour after a 20 lap race..
